He had been a Tapestry board member since 2006 and served as Board Chairman since 2014. Jide Zeitlin, who was named CEO of Tapestry in September 2019 , has stepped down amid allegations of an improper sexual relationship that took place 13 years ago. Zeitlin, who is married, is one of only four black chief executives in the Fortune 500.
